I’ve had clients ask me to to negotiate the taxability of debt forgiveness. Unfortunately, no lender (including the SBA) is actually able to do such anything. Just like your employer ought to be needed to send a W-2 to you every year, a lender is required to send 1099 forms to any or all borrowers in which have debt pardoned. That said, just because lenders must be present to send 1099s doesn’t imply that you personally automatically will get hit having a huge tax bill. Why? In most cases, the borrower can be a corporate entity, and you might be just a personal guarantor. I am aware that some lenders only send 1099s to the borrower. The impact of the 1099 in your own personal situation will vary depending on kind of entity the borrower is (C-Corp, S-Corp, LLC, etc). Most CPAs will be able to explain how a 1099 would manifest itself.
